Opublikowano 27 Września 20232 l Witajcie, Przedstawiam nową wersję funkcji związanej z zadaniami - 'pc_select_vid', którą niedawno zmodyfikowałem. Teraz jest ona bardziej bezpieczna i zawiera wszystkie niezbędne walidacje. Zmiany: Zaktualizowałem typy danych na bardziej precyzyjne. Zmieniłem nazwy zmiennych na bardziej opisowe (ch - > currentCharacter, vid -> targetVid, new_ch -> targetCharacter). Dodałem kontrolę argumentów przekazywanych do funkcji za pomocą lua_isnumber, aby sprawdzić, że otrzymano poprawny typ danych. Dodałem dodatkowe logowanie błędów w celu łatwiejszego diagnozowania problemów. Dodałem sprawdzenie czy wskaźnik do aktualnej postaci nie jest nullptr. Implementacja: 📁 Lokalizacja pliku: 'game -> questlua_pc.cpp' 🔍 Szukaj Tylko zalogowani Zaloguj się, aby wyświetlić chronioną treść Ten post zawiera treści dostępne tylko dla członków. Zaloguj się lub utwórz konto, aby odblokować całą zawartość tego posta. Zaloguj się Utwórz konto ♻️ Zamień:
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to